There are universal traits amongst all dance music. Baroque binary dance represents one of the high points of western dance and dance music. All baroque dances followed the same form: aabb. Section a began with tonic and moved to dominant by the end. Suite - groups of dances during the baroque period. Began as lute dances, but harpsichord composers and appropriated the lute style. Could be played on either lute or harpsichord. It was a means to effect two ends: Underlying approach to art and music in the baroque period and was often desired to create drama. Organization of dances into suites permitted composers to create longer, unified works from short component dances. Nuclear dances are the dances where it"s necessary to form a heart of a suite. Optional dances came in a way to get rid of the suite and they originated from the french province.
